Higher Education Testing And Assessment Market Size 2025-2029
The higher education testing and assessment market size is forecast to increase by USD 7.57 billion at a CAGR of 6.6% between 2024 and 2029.
- The market is witnessing significant shifts as educational institutions increasingly adopt formative assessment methods. This transition signifies a move away from traditional summative assessments towards ongoing evaluation of student progress, enabling educators to identify and address learning gaps in real-time. Moreover, the role of educational technologies in testing and assessment is evolving, with advancements in artificial intelligence, machine learning, and data analytics enabling more personalized and effective assessments. However, challenges persist in this market. One major obstacle is the weak assessment mechanism of online tests, which has become increasingly prevalent due to the shift towards remote learning. Ensuring the validity and reliability of online assessments is a significant challenge, as issues such as test security, proctoring, and test-taker authenticity must be addressed to maintain the integrity of the assessment process.
- Additionally, ensuring equal access to technology and internet connectivity for all students is crucial to prevent disparities in testing outcomes. Companies seeking to capitalize on market opportunities in this space must focus on developing robust and secure online assessment solutions while addressing these challenges effectively.

Higher education institutions in North America are integrating diverse testing and assessment solutions, including adaptive learning and learning analytics, to enhance student performance. The US National Assessment of Educational Progress (NAEP), administered by the National Center for Education Statistics (NCES) under the Institute of Education Sciences (IES) of the Department of Education (DoED), is an example of a mandatory assessment program. This initiative tests the educational progress of students in grades four, eight, and 12 in mathematics, science, history of the US, and technology. What are the key market drivers leading to the rise in the adoption of Higher Education Testing And Assessment Industry?
- The shift towards formative assessment in educational institutions is the primary market driver, as this approach allows for ongoing evaluation and improvement of student learning.
- In the realm of higher education, there has been a significant shift towards formative assessments from traditional summative assessments. Formative assessments, which include strategic questioning, projects, questionnaires, quizzes, and other techniques, offer valuable insights into students' learning progress throughout their academic journey. These assessments not only enhance students' performance but also foster interaction between students and faculty, making them an essential component of effective learning. Initiatives like the Re-Engineering Assessment Practices (REAP) have been instrumental in promoting the adoption of formative assessments in higher education. For instance, the University of Edinburgh's principle of good formative assessment, under the REAP, advocates for the use of these techniques to help students monitor, self-direct, and manage their learning.
- The digital age has further revolutionized the assessment landscape with the introduction of computer-based testing, online testing, remote proctoring, learning analytics, and diagnostic assessments. These technologies facilitate data analysis and provide instant feedback, enabling educators to tailor their instruction to individual students' needs. Moreover, they cater to the growing number of adult learners who require flexible learning solutions. What challenges does the Higher Education Testing And Assessment Industry face during its growth?
- The inadequate assessment mechanism of online tests poses a significant challenge to the growth of the industry, as it undermines the validity and reliability of test results.
- The market is witnessing significant advancements with the integration of technologies such as machine learning and artificial intelligence. These technologies enable personalized learning and competency-based education by providing customized assessments to students. Instructional design and faculty development are also being enhanced through natural language processing and test development tools. However, the issue of test bias remains a concern in this market. Despite these advancements, the adoption of technology for testing and assessment in higher education is not universal. In some developing countries, end-users prefer offline testing due to concerns over the reliability of online assessments. For instance, in certain countries, competitive examinations are still checked manually due to the perceived risk of answer manipulation in online tests.
- This trend is hindering the growth of the market during the forecast period. Universities, corporations, and governments worldwide are increasingly investing in software solutions and online platforms for testing and assessment. However, the assessment mechanism of online tests must be robust and reliable to gain widespread acceptance. Ensuring test security and reducing the risk of answer manipulation are essential to promoting the adoption of technology in higher education testing and assessment.

Recent Development and News in Higher Education Testing And Assessment Market
- In February 2024, Pearson, a leading education company, introduced a new adaptive assessment platform for higher education institutions. This innovative solution uses artificial intelligence to personalize testing experiences based on students' learning styles and abilities, aiming to enhance the accuracy and effectiveness of assessment results (Pearson Press Release, 2024).
- In May 2025, ETS (Educational Testing Service) and Microsoft announced a strategic partnership to develop advanced testing solutions using Microsoft's Azure cloud platform. This collaboration aims to improve test security, accessibility, and data analytics for higher education institutions (ETS Press Release, 2025).
- In October 2024, ACT, Inc. Raised USD100 million in a funding round led by Blackbaud, a technology company specializing in education solutions. The investment will support the expansion of ACT's digital assessment and testing services, enabling the company to cater to a broader range of educational institutions (ACT, Inc. Press Release, 2024).
- In January 2025, the European Union introduced new regulations on data protection in education, including stricter requirements for handling student data in testing and assessment processes. These regulations aim to enhance data security and privacy for students, requiring testing companies to adapt their processes accordingly (European Commission Press Release, 2025).
